Hardware Design Engineer
This company is a leading global technology and consulting company with a world-wide customer base and is the technological partner for their core business operations and is a world-leader in providing proprietary solutions in specific market segments, including the energy market. The energy practice within the company provides a comprehensive set of IT/OT solutions and services with a focus in innovation and customer value. This company sells products and solutions to over 200 utilities in North America.
Our Design & Support Engineer will utilize knowledge of SCADA systems, both Master side and RTUs as well as communication protocols such as DNP3.0, IEC60870-5-104 and others, to test new product releases, hardware, software, and provide customer support. Will maintain system hardware including designing /updating boards as needed.
Responsibilities
  • Support customer base via troubleshooting, repair, and proactive maintenance.
  • Test new software and hardware product releases from the R&D HW team.
  • Work with customers to optimize the use of their system.
  • Work onsite with customers commissioning ACS RTU products.
  • Identify and take the necessary steps to make corrections for issues arising after installation.
  • Coordinate with the RTU team to streamline or automate processes for increased productivity enhance reliability.
  • Create shell, python and cmi scripts as required to meet customer requirements.
  • Provide instruction in all facets of Linux and SCADA operations.
  • Design / modify microprocessor-based boards to communicate over serial or Ethernet and collect data from local inputs both analog and digital.
Required Experience
  • A minimum of 5 years of experience in administering, testing, maintaining, and integrating various Microprocessor based RTUs.
  • Experience understanding and troubleshooting network communications.
  • Experience developing and presenting training materials and instruction to diverse audiences.
  • Minimum 4-year Electrical Engineering Degree or equivalent.
